In accordance with Kentucky MAC law (Ky.Rev.Stat.Ann. §304.17A-162), the CVS Caremark® Pharmacy Portal may reflect products, as applicable, for which MAC adjustments with retroactive effective dates have been made as a result of granted MAC appeals.
Pharmacies that filled prescriptions on or after the retroactive effective date for patients covered under the same health benefit plan can reverse and resubmit the claim in order to receive payment based on the adjusted maximum allowable cost.
Individual unit MAC prices can be viewed through the use of the CVS Caremark price look up function of the Pharmacy Portal located at: https://rxservices.cvscaremark.com
